How Unleashing the Land Rover Defender PHEV: Electric Power Meets Off-Road Capability Actually Works

At its core, the Defender PHEV combines a conventional internal combustion engine with an electric motor and a rechargeable battery pack. This setup allows the vehicle to run on electric power for short distances, typically in urban or low-load scenarios, before the gasoline engine engages to extend range. For off-road use, the electric motor can provide instant torque at low speeds, which helps with crawling over obstacles or navigating technical terrain without excessive engine noise or vibration. The system manages power distribution between the front and rear axles, maintaining the robust capability that Defender owners expect while optimizing efficiency during everyday driving. In practice, this means a driver can use electric power for local errands, then rely on the full hybrid system when heading onto trails or long highways, with the vehicle seamlessly transitioning between modes.

Does the hybrid system affect off-road performance compared to traditional models?

The integration of electric power adds low-speed torque, which can improve crawling ability and control on steep or slippery surfaces. The overall weight distribution and chassis tuning remain focused on maintaining Defender's characteristic balance between on-road stability and off-road articulation. While the presence of batteries and an electric motor changes some dynamics, engineers work to preserve the rugged feel that defines the model.

What are the practical considerations for charging the Defender PHEV?

Charging can be done at home using a standard outlet or faster Level 2 equipment, as well as at public charging stations where available. The flexibility to top up the battery during daily routines helps maximize electric driving without requiring specific destination charging. For users with limited access to charging, the vehicle operates as a conventional hybrid when the battery depletes, ensuring that range anxiety does not restrict its utility on longer trips or remote adventures.
